
Financial Regulation Analysis
Financial Regulation Analysis involves examining the rules and laws that govern financial institutions and markets to ensure they operate fairly and transparently. This analysis assesses how effectively these regulations protect consumers, maintain market integrity, and reduce risks of financial crises. It considers the impact of policies on economic stability and growth, evaluating whether they achieve their intended goals without stifling innovation. By assessing compliance and enforcement, regulation analysis helps identify weaknesses and propose improvements, ultimately aiming to create a safer and more efficient financial system for everyone.
